19204629456320 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and and e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 19204629456320:

26 × 5 × 7 × 112 × 372 × 73 × 709

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 37 × 37 × 73 × 709)

    This is a very rough estimate, based on a speaking rate of half a second every third order of magnitude. If you speak quickly, you could probably say any randomly-chosen number between one and a thousand in around half a second. Very big numbers obviously take longer to say, so we add half a second for every extra x1000. (We do not count involuntary pauses, bathroom breaks or the necessity of sleep in our calculation!)
